The Ulster Defence Regiment


The Ulster Defence Regiment (UDR) Benevolent Fund or "Ben Fund "was established as a charitable trust in 1972 with the aim of providing grants paid out immediately to bereaved families and to help serving and ex-soldiers and their families in need, primarily but not solely as a result of their UDR service.More Information on the UDR Benevolent Fund

 

 

The Royal Irish Regiment

 

The Royal Irish Benevolent Fund was established as a charitable trust in 1992 on the formation of the Regiment and is similar to that of the UDR Benevolent Fund. The aim is to render aid, financial or otherwise, to members, their widows and/or dependants who are in need or in financial difficulties.More Information on the Royal Irish Benevolent Fund
